Facilities Ticket — Door Sensor Recall (Bldg C, Harwick Park)

Heads up, folks — the Ventrell-series door sensors on levels 2 and 3 are being recalled, so you'll be swapping them out this week. Park in the contractor bay, sign in at the hut, and grab a hi-vis before heading up. The sensors pop off with a flathead, but mind the wiring clips — they snap easily. Doors will be in manual mode during the swap. To get through the stairwell doors while you work, use the pass code below.

door code, yagap-bahof: bdg-O-05

Subject: Cut-over complete — Harlowe Foods SFTP drop

Team, the migration of the Harlowe Foods nightly file drop from the old Brindlewick host to the new managed transfer service finished last night. Files now land in the inbound staging area and are picked up by the Ferryline ingest job every fifteen minutes. The legacy host will be decommissioned at month end, so update any local scripts. For reference, the new connection settings are as follows.

deployment values, kajep-kageg:
[praix]
host = praix.paliqcorp.corp
user = praix_svc
database = praix_prod

Ticket: Config drift on the Haldane garage occupancy feed. The Ostermill node is publishing counts every 5s while the other three garages publish every 15s, which skews the aggregation window downstream in Lotgrid. Someone hot-patched the interval during the holiday surge and never reverted. Please review the diff and restore parity across all nodes. The intended baseline configuration is as follows.

settings of kahip-hafop:
ralix:
  log_level: warn
  metrics_host: metrics.ralix.zemvarsys.internal
  pin: 8273
  pool_size: 8

### Audit Item 7 — Test-Data Factory Library

Plugin authors using the Thistledown factory library must confirm generated fixtures contain no copied production records and that seed values are deterministic per build. Verify your plugin pins a supported library version; unpinned builds fail the audit. Compatibility questions and exemption requests go through the library's designated maintainer, named below.

named custodian: Brivan Eliath Quenox Frador